Coffee & Conversation sponsered by Upper Dublin Lutheran Church




This summer we kicked off a new God on Tap series called “Coffee and Conversation” (more here)  at Danielle’s Espresso Cafe in Maple Glen and we had a great response.



Around 8-10 people gathered each time and the conversations covered a

whole range of things in life and faith. A few things stood out for me:



  • we had new and different people each time, so the conversation was always different
  • most of the people haven’t attended our pub nights at Forest and

    Main, so we reached a whole different group of people with the same idea

    of connecting in conversation and getting beyond the church building
  • people from my church that came met people that went to different services (we have 3 on Sunday morning) for the first time


People are already asking when we are going to do it again.
